Abstract

The biaxially oriented polyester film of the present invention useful for twist wrapping is prepared by biaxially drawing a polyester sheet which has a glass transition temperature (Tg) of at least 60° C., in the longitudinal and transverse directions, wherein the biaxially oriented film has a specific gravity of 1.38 or less.

Claims (14)

1. A biaxially oriented polyester film prepared by biaxially drawing a polyester sheet which has a glass transition temperature (Tg) of 60° C. or higher, in the longitudinal and transverse directions, wherein the biaxially oriented film has a specific gravity of 1.38 or less and a dead-fold retainability of at least 60% defined as below:

Dead-fold retainability (%)=(180−θ)×100/180

wherein θ is an angle formed when a polyester film sheet is folded under a pressure of 30 psi for 3 seconds at room temperature and the folded sheet is kept at a vertical position for 1 hr.

2. The biaxially oriented polyester film of claim 1 , wherein the polyester sheet is prepared from one or more resins obtained by polycondensation of a dicarboxylic acid component and an alkylene glycol component.

3. The biaxially oriented film of claim 2 , wherein the dicarboxylic acid component comprises dimethyl terephthalate or terephthalic acid.

4. The biaxially oriented film of claim 3 , wherein the dicarboxylic acid component further comprises at least one aromatic dicarboxylic acid selected from the group consisting of isophthalic acid, naphthalene dicarboxylic acid, dimethyl isophthalate, dimethyl-2,6-naphthalene dicarboxylate.

5. The biaxially oriented film of claim 2 , wherein the alkylene glycol component comprises ethylene glycol.

6. The biaxially oriented film of claim 5 , wherein the alkylene glycol component further comprises at least one alkylene glycol selected from the group consisting of diethylene glycol, trimethylene glycol, tetramethylene glycol, 1,4-cyclohexane dimethanol and 2,2-dimethyl(−1,3-propane)diol.

7. The biaxially oriented film of claim 1 , wherein the crystallization degree of the film is less than 40%.

8. The biaxially oriented film of claim 1 , wherein the product of drawing ratios in the longitudinal and transverse directions is in the range of 4 to 20.

9. The biaxially oriented film of claim 1 , wherein the drawing in the longitudinal direction is conducted at a temperature in the range of Tg of the polyester sheet and Tg+30° C.

10. The biaxially oriented film of claim 1 , wherein the drawing in the transverse direction is conducted at a temperature in the range of Tg of the polyester sheet +10° C. and Tg+40° C.

11. The biaxially oriented film of claim 1 , wherein the refractive indexes of the film in the longitudinal and transverse directions are each 1.6 or higher.

12. The biaxially oriented film of claim 1 , wherein the film is used for twist wrapping.
